| Unit Model | HT-680MB |
| Applicable Temperature | -25℃ ~ +25℃ |
| Box Volume | ≤27m³ |
| Cooling Capacity | 0℃: 6300 W 30℃: 3170 W |
| Compressor Model | GY21 |
| Compressor Displacement | 209 CC |
| Lubricating Oil | PAG 68 |
| Evaporator Material | Inner grooved copper tube |
| Evaporator Fans | 3 Scroll Brushless Fans |
| Condenser Material | Parallel flow condenser |
| Condenser Fans | 2 Fans |
| Refrigerant | R404a |
| Refrigerant Charge | 2.8KG |
| Temperature Control | Electronic digital display |
| Safety Protection | High and low pressure switch |
| Defrosting System | Hot gas defrost automatically |
| Dimensions/Weight | 1840*700*650 mm <139 KG |
| Drive Model | Non-independent engine driven |
